Paraglider crash "on the cliff and then into the sea" leaves one seriously injured

Notícias de Coimbra8 September 2026 at 17:28

A man was seriously injured this afternoon due to the crash of the paraglider he was in. The accident occurred near a beach, in the cliff area, and the paraglider ended up falling both on the cliff and into the sea.

The pilot was rescued at the scene and taken to a hospital unit, having suffered injuries considered serious. The competent authorities were alerted to the occurrence and went to the scene to provide support and investigate the circumstances of the accident.

The paraglider crash is believed to have occurred under conditions that have not yet been fully clarified. The authorities are investigating the causes of the incident, which involved only one person.

Magnitude 2.9 earthquake felt today on São Miguel island

A magnitude 2.9 earthquake on the Richter scale was felt today in some municipalities on the island of São Miguel, in the Azores, the Azores Seismic and Volcanic Information and Surveillance Centre (CIVISA) reported. The event was recorded at 16:41 local time (17:41 in Lisbon), with the epicenter approximately four kilometres west-southwest of Furnas.
